viernes, 5 de noviembre de 2010

lagrnange

%lagrnage
x=[-1;0;1;2];
y=[-2,1,3,13];
n=length(x)-1;
l=zeros(n+1,n+1);
for k=1:n+1
v=1;
for j=1:n+1
if k~=j
v=conv(v,poly(x(j)))/(x(k)-x(j));
end
end
l(k,:)=v;
end
l

No hay comentarios:

Publicar un comentario

Se ha producido un error en este gadget.